준비된 4권의 교재에 대해서 접근 순서와 각각의 장점, 특히 중요하게 보아야할 챕터를 아래와 같이 정리합니다.
1️⃣ 기초 다지기 (입문 → 기본기)
👉 Do it! 자료구조와 함께 배우는 알고리즘 입문: 자바 편
- 장점: 자료구조/기본 알고리즘 구현 중심, 예제 풍부, 자바 코드 기반
- 목표: 배열, 스택/큐, 리스트, 트리, 정렬, 탐색 알고리즘 원리 학습
- 권장 챕터: Ch 02~06 (기본 자료구조, 검색, 스택·큐, 재귀, 정렬)
⏳ 기간: 2주 정도 → ADV 준비 전 기본기 세팅
2️⃣ 문제 풀이 감각 익히기 (ADV 실전 대비)
👉 코딩 테스트 합격자 되기: 자바편
- 장점: 프로그래머스 기출 기반 + 자바 중심 설명
- 목표: ADV 단골 유형(구현, DFS/BFS, 해시, 시뮬레이션) 빠르게 학습
- 권장 챕터: 11장 그래프, 14장 시뮬레이션 (ADV 대비), 12장 백트래킹(심화 준비)
⏳ 기간: 3주 정도 → ADV 시험 직전까지 풀기 좋은 문제 많음
3️⃣ 알고리즘 심화 & A형 대비
👉 프로그래머스 코딩 테스트 문제 풀이 전략: 자바 편
- 장점: 프로그래머스 레벨 기반으로 난이도 상승, 카카오/삼성 스타일 문제 포함
- 목표: A형에서 중요한 DP, 그래프 탐색, 백트래킹, 구현 문제 강화
- 권장 챕터: 10장 동적 프로그래밍, 11장 그래프와 트리, 12장 구현
⏳ 기간: 4~5주 → A형 준비 핵심
4️⃣ Pro 준비 & 실전 시뮬레이션
👉 이것이 취업을 위한 코딩 테스트다
- 장점: 알고리즘 범위 가장 넓음, 삼성/카카오 기출 포함
- 목표: Pro 대비용 심화 알고리즘 (최단경로, 위상정렬, 문자열, 플로이드, DP 심화)
- 권장 챕터: Part 2 전체, 특히 08 DP, 09 최단 경로, 10 그래프 이론
- 보너스: Ch 19 삼성전자 기출(아기 상어 등) → 실제 시험 연습
⏳ 기간: 최소 6~8주 → Pro 단계 필수
🚀 최종 추천 학습 순서
- Do it! → 기본 자료구조 & 정렬/탐색 원리 → ADV 기초 체력
- 합격자 되기 → 프로그래머스 기반 문제풀이 → ADV 실전 준비
- 문제 풀이 전략 → DP, 그래프, 백트래킹 심화 → A형 대비
- 이코테 → 광범위 알고리즘 + 삼성 기출 → Pro 대비
✅ 요약:
- ADV 준비: Do it! + 합격자 되기
- A형 준비: 합격자 되기 + 문제 풀이 전략
- Pro 준비: 문제 풀이 전략 + 이코테
---
참고: 이 글은 다른 사람을 위한 것이 아니라, 제 스스로를 독려하고 기록하기 위해 작성한 글입니다.
Note: These posts are for self-motivation and record-keeping, not for an audience.
'[끄적임] (Notes & Thoughts)' 카테고리의 다른 글
| 교재는 모두 준비되었다, 다만 아직 읽지 않았을 뿐이다 (0) | 2025.09.24 |
|---|---|
| [프로그래머스] 코딩 입문 트레이닝 캘린더 (0) | 2025.09.21 |
| [프로그래머스] 코딩 기초 트레이닝 캘린더 (0) | 2025.09.21 |